Ras Beyyada
Ras Beyyada is a hill in Skhirate-Témara Prefecture, Rabat-Salé-Kénitra and has an elevation of 205 metres. Ras Beyyada is situated nearby to the area Mdal Ben Chaoui, as well as near the locality Douar Laaraara Charqiy.| Tap on a place to explore it |
